There are several minor distinctions between wrought and cast aluminum alloys, such as that cast alloys can contain extra considerable amounts of other steels than functioned alloys. Yet the most significant difference in between these alloys is the fabrication process whereby they will most likely to deliver the last product. Apart from some surface area treatments, cast alloys will certainly leave their mold in practically the specific strong kind wanted, whereas functioned alloys will undertake a number of modifications while in their strong state.

Pass away spreading is the name offered to the procedure of producing complex steel elements through use of molds of the element, likewise recognized as dies. It generates more components than any various other procedure, with a high degree of precision and repeatability. There are three sub-processes that fall under the group of die casting: gravity die casting (or permanent mold casting), low-pressure die casting and high-pressure die casting.


Despite the sub-process, the die spreading procedure can their explanation be broken down right into 6 steps. After the purity of the alloy is examined, passes away are developed. To prepare the passes away for spreading, it is essential that the passes away are tidy, to make sure that no residue from previous productions continue to be. After cleansing, the ejection lubrication is put on the die to make sure a smooth launch.


The pure steel, likewise known as ingot, is included to the furnace and kept at the molten temperature level of the steel, which is then transferred to the injection chamber and injected into the die. The pressure is then preserved as the metal solidifies - Casting Foundry. Once the metal strengthens, the cooling process begins



The thicker the wall surface of the part, the longer the cooling time due to the quantity of interior steel that additionally requires to cool. After the part is fully cooled, the die cuts in half open and an ejection mechanism pushes the part out. Complying with the ejection, the die is closed for the following shot cycle.

Today, leading suppliers use x-ray screening to see the whole interior of elements without cutting into them. To get to the completed product, there are three primary alloys used as die casting product to choose from: zinc, light weight aluminum and magnesium.



Zinc is one of the most previously owned alloys for die casting due to its reduced expense of raw materials. It's additionally among the more powerful and secure steels. And also, it has superb electrical and thermal conductivity. Its rust resistance likewise permits the parts to be long-term, and it is among the a lot more castable alloys as a result of its lower melting point.
